Construction Design Management Co-ordinator

£15,912 – £35,196 (BAR at top PO2 £31,812)

Working here in Property Services, your role will see you providing Strathclyde Police with a professional technical support service for all CDM regulations, Asbestos Management, Legionella monitoring and the provision of the Disability Discrimination Act. As well as staying on top of all health and safety issues relating to property matters, you’ll also find yourself liaising closely with senior managers and Divisional Commanders when it comes to organising all work carried out on properties. AS well as a degree in a relevant building discipline, you’ll need to have sound technical knowledge and exposure to all aspects of CDM, gained within the building industry. (Ref R74/08/S1)
